- Flat roof installation - needed when a commercial building requires a durable, low-maintenance roofing solution.
- Metal roof installation - suitable for businesses seeking a long-lasting and weather-resistant roof system.
- Built-up roofing (BUR) - ideal for large commercial structures that need proven, heavy-duty roofing options.
- EPDM roofing installation - used for commercial warehouses and industrial facilities in need of a flexible, waterproof membrane.
- Thermoplastic roofing (TPO) - recommended for businesses looking for energy-efficient and heat-reflective roofing solutions.
Commercial roof installation services involve the process of designing and installing new roofing systems on various types of commercial properties. This service typically begins with assessing the building’s structure, size, and specific needs to determine the most suitable roofing materials and design. Contractors work to ensure the new roof provides durability, weather resistance, and long-term performance, often using advanced techniques and quality materials to meet the unique demands of commercial structures.
These services address several common problems faced by commercial property owners, such as aging roofs that are prone to leaks, damage from severe weather, or the need for improved energy efficiency. Installing a new roof can help prevent water infiltration, reduce maintenance costs, and enhance the overall safety of the building. Additionally, a properly installed roof can improve insulation, leading to better energy management and lower operational expenses over time.
Properties that typically utilize commercial roof installation services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and healthcare complexes. These structures often have large, flat, or low-slope roofs that require specialized installation techniques. The choice of roofing material can vary based on the property’s purpose, budget, and environmental conditions, with options such as built-up roofing, single-ply membranes, or metal roofing being common.

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for commercial installations typ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of roofing system selected. For example, single-ply membranes may cost around $4 to $7 per square foot, while built-up roofs can be closer to $8 to $10 per square foot.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for commercial roof installation gener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. These costs can vary based on the complexity of the project and local labor rates in Johnstown, CO and nearby areas.
Total Project Costs - Overall costs for commercial roof installation typically range from $5,000 to $50,000 or more, depending on the size and scope of the roof. Larger or more complex projects t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include permits, disposal of old roofing materials, and site preparation, which can add $500 to $5,000 or more to the total cost. These fees vary based on local regulations and project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
